Neeleswaram (Kasaragod): In a bizarre incident, a young man climbed onto his neighbour’s rooftop with a machete and threatened to commit suicide. He was brought down safely by the police, fire force, and local residents.
The incident took place around 1:30 pm on Sunday when a man named Sreedharan used a ladder to climb onto the roof of his neighbour Lakshmi’s house. Once there, he brandished a machete and issued threats.
Upon receiving the information, Neeleswaram Sub-Inspector K.V. Pradeep and his team rushed to the spot and attempted to bring Sreedharan down, but he refused to cooperate. Sreedharan’s main demand was to eat beef and porotta. Despite efforts by locals and police to procure the items, being a Sunday, they were unable to find them. The Fireforce too reached the spot.
Meanwhile, Sub-Inspector KV Pradeep, along with Civil Police Officers Rajeevan Kankol, Sajil Kumar, and Home Guard Gopinathan, climbed onto the roof with the help of local residents and brought Sreedharan down safely. According to locals, Sreedharan, who showed signs of mental distress, has made multiple suicide threats in the past.
